What are the responsibilities and job description for the Building Maintenance Technician position at City of Murfreesboro?
This position is considered a Safety-Sensitive position. Applicants who pass the interview process will be subject to drug and alcohol testing.
The purpose of this position is to perform maintenance and maintain the pl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ems for the Cities multiple buildings and facilities.
Essential Functions:
- Must be able to communicate with others in spoken and written English to ensure the safe and efficient operations of the business.
- Inspects buildings and grounds; ensures safety issues are addressed.
- Conduct minor electrical, plumbing and building repairs.
- Troubleshoot and perform preventive maintenance inspections, minor repairs and general maintenance on HVAC, plumbing and hot water systems for multiple buildings.
- Schedules all routine maintenance checks on filters, fire alarms, etc., on a timely basis and maintains related records.
- Plans preventative maintenance schedule; schedules preventive maintenance on buildings' mechanical and electrical systems on a timely basis and maintains related records.
- Minor carpentry work, drywall repairs, painting of interior walls and removal of graffiti on exterior walls.
- Troubleshoot and perform minor electrical repairs on buildings power and lighting system or contracts larger repairs on mechanical equipment, buildings, and grounds.
- Assists in maintaining the Civic Plaza Fountain.
- Moves, repairs and assembles miscellaneous office equipment and furniture.
- Performs other work as assigned.
Physical Demands:
- Performs work that involves walking or standing virtually all the time.
- Involves exerting between 20 and 50 pounds of force on a regular and recurring basis and 50 to 100 pounds of force on an occasional basis.
Minimum Education and Experience Requirements:
- Requires High School diploma or GED equivalent.
- Formal training, special courses or self-education with equivalent to satisfactory completion of one (1) year of college education or closely related field.
- Requires over two (2) years in building maintenance and repair or closely related.
Special Certifications and Licenses:
- Must have a valid driver's license.
- HVAC Preferred.
- Ability to take and pass the NATE HVAC Certification.
- Ability to take and pass the EPA 406 certification.
- Ability to take and complete the Cross-Connection Course.
